find an equation for the set of coordinates

I have the above plot with a different set of coordinates for each object(labeled by different colors). I was wondering if there was a way to find an approximate equation for each object in matlab.
I was thinking about smoothing out the "rougher" parts to make it easier but I'm not sure how to go about doing that. any ideas?
thanks

How about just taking the average of the coordinates
windowWidth = 5;
newx = conv(x, ones(1, windowWidth)/windowWidth, 'same');
newy = conv(y, ones(1, windowWidth)/windowWidth, 'same');

Huh? Why? conv2() is already like doing a polyfit of order 1 (a line). If you want higher order for less smoothing, use a Savitzky-Golay filter, sgolayfilt() in the Signal Processing Toolbox.
Perhaps increasing sampling and getting a smoother curve via splines would interest you. See attached demo.
